RI is Way Out-of-Step When it Comes to Guns in Schools

Just how out-of-step is Rhode Island with respect to allowing concealed carry in schools? Very. Rhode Island is currently one of only 4 states in the U.S. that generally allows the concealed carry of firearms in schools. Nationally, Rhode Island is an outlier in terms...
